Director, DEI (Pixar)


The DEI organization is focused on creating, leading, and supporting our people and culture inclusion strategies. In collaboration with Segment & Enterprise DEI as well as HR, this organization will provide subject matter expertise on relevant inclusion practices to business leaders and employees to develop and nurture an inclusive workplace where all employees can belong and thrive.


Reporting to the VP of DEI and accountability to the VP, People at Pixar, this role will be part of the broader HR organization with the following key responsibilities:


  • Manage local DEI team of 2 full time Pixar employees: Sr. Manager and Specialist.
  • Partner with Executive team, People team and DEI team to develop and implement tightly integrated solutions that drive inclusive behaviors and practices that align with company D&I objectives.
  • Serve as a key strategic partner, cultural resource and thought leader to employees and coach/educate both employees and leaders on relevant DEI topics and initiatives.
  • Provide coaching, education and consultation to HR and studio leaders to develop goals and practices that positively impact diversity and inclusion outcomes.
  • Develop and implement an insights driven strategic plan for diversity and inclusion (people and culture) across associated client groups while working closely with the businesses, People Partners and the VP DEI to create a cohesive strategy across Pixar.
  • Moves thoughtfully and quickly, with regular communication and collaboration with partners and drives visible progress against objectives
  • Consult with Talent Acquisition to diversify talent pipelines and external/industry partners to source high caliber talent that reflects our audiences.
  • Drive DEI learning programs and initiatives that focus on education at all levels.
  • Localized Crisis/Incident Management - Partner with VP, DEI, HR and Leadership along with communication partners to manage crisis/communications locally. Ensure approach balances needs of lines of business and broader company.
  • Partner with Workforce Insights and VP DEI to develop and deliver consistent metrics and reporting to enable leaders to assess outcomes, understand trends and inform decisions on how to achieve goals.
  • Continuously enhance DEI practices through providing insights that increase awareness of market/industry trends and sharing best practices to support an inclusive environment across the Company
  • Lead local Pixar DEI team to drive strategy that is localized to the Pixar Studio.
  • Oversee and support our Studio Resource Groups by providing coordinated tools, resources, guidance and thought leadership to meet D&I goals and align to Company strategy.


Skills/Qualifications:


  • Ability to tackle issues at systemic level and provide outcomes for all stakeholders
  • Leads with the business in mind; thinks and acts strategically
  • Knowledge of best practices and innovative talent trends with a focus on creative and production talent.
  • Cultivates curiosity AND focuses on impact
  • 10+ years of diversity, equity and inclusion and/or HR experience, ideally with a global company or production studio
  • Effectively builds partnerships and influences stakeholders and decision-making at all levels of a complex organization
  • Experienced in leading the integration of multiple data sources (including primary and secondary research, internal sentiment, social media) into clear, actionable insights and compelling storytelling
  • Proven success working in a highly matrixed and global business environment.
  • Proven ability to build relationships at all levels and drive change in creative and production environments.
  • Built and motivated high-performing, cross functional and collaborative teams
  • Master’s Degree or equivalent work experience in the areas of DEI, or HR
  • Compelling track record of working collaboratively with the business, Senior Leaders, HR and DEI to drive outcomes and change.


The hiring range for this position in California is $216,450 to $264,550 per year based on a forty-hour work week. The amount of hours scheduled per week may vary based on business needs. The base pay actually offered will take into account internal equity and also may vary depending on the candidate's geographic region, job-related knowledge, skills, and experience among other factors. A bonus and/or long-term incentive units may be provided as part of the compensation package, in addition to the full range of medical, financial, and/or other benefits, dependent on the level and position offered.
